Docker是目前最流行的容器技術,是一種將應用程序和依賴項打包到一個輕量級容器中的方式。Docker配置文件config.json是一個定義Docker特定環境變量和行為的JSON文件。
在Docker中,config.json文件包含有關存儲庫,鏡像,容器和網絡的信息。這個文件可以用來修改默認設置和配置Docker的特定功能,例如更改鏡像存儲位置或啟用實驗性功能。
{
"auths": {},
"HttpHeaders": {
"User-Agent": "Docker-Client/19.03.12-ce (Linux)"
},
"detachKeys": "ctrl-q,ctrl-q",
"debug": true,
"experimental": false,
"host": "tcp://127.0.0.1:2376",
"log-driver": "",
"log-opts": {},
"labels": {},
"max-concurrent-downloads": 3,
"registry-mirrors": [],
"storage-driver": "overlay2"
}
在這個例子中,config.json定義了一些Docker的默認設置,例如HTTP頭,鏡像的存儲位置,容器的detach鍵,log driver,標簽和實驗性功能等。
默認情況下,Docker會在運行時自動生成這個配置文件,但是您可以創建一個自定義的config.json文件并使用--config-file參數指定文件路徑來啟動Docker守護進程??梢酝ㄟ^手動編輯這個文件來修改Docker的默認設置。
總之,config.json文件是Docker非常重要的一個配置文件,可以通過修改來實現對Docker特定功能的配置。相信深入了解和掌握config.json的使用,能夠為使用Docker帶來更多的便利和靈活性。
上一篇idea 配置vue模板
下一篇python 的調用函數